要避免HAProxy对backend的健康检查日志打印到日志中,可以通过配置HAProxy的日志级别来实现。

  1. 打开HAProxy的配置文件(通常是位于/etc/haproxy/haproxy.cfg)。
  2. 找到日志配置部分,通常以"global"或"defaults"开头。
  3. 在日志配置中添加或修改"option dontlog-normal"。这个选项将禁止HAProxy记录正常的HTTP请求和响应日志。
  4. 如果需要禁止HAProxy记录健康检查日志,请添加或修改"option dontlog-health-checks"。这个选项将禁止HAProxy记录对backend的健康检查日志。
  5. 保存并关闭配置文件。
  6. 重新加载HAProxy配置,以使更改生效(通常可以使用"service haproxy reload"命令)。

通过以上步骤,您可以配置HAProxy不记录backend的健康检查日志到日志文件中。请注意,禁用健康检查日志可能会导致您无法监控backend的健康状态,因此请确保您有其他途径来监控backend的健康状况。

如何避免haproxy对backend的健康检查日志打印到日志中

原文地址: https://www.cveoy.top/t/topic/iwuG 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录